In the morning, start your educational tour by visiting the National Gallery of Modern Art. Explore the impressive collection of modern and contemporary Indian art, including paintings, sculptures, and installations. Afterward, head to the Visvesvaraya Industrial and Technological Museum for a fascinating insight into science and technology. Learn about the contributions of Indian scientists and engineers through interactive exhibits. In the evening, visit the Government Museum, which houses a wide range of artifacts, including archaeological finds, numismatics, and traditional crafts.
Start your day by visiting the Indian Institute of Science, one of the premier scientific research institutions in India. Take a guided tour of the campus and learn about the groundbreaking research conducted here. In the afternoon, visit the Jawaharlal Nehru Planetarium for an educational and entertaining journey through the universe. Experience fascinating shows on astronomy and space exploration. In the evening, explore the Book Market near Avenue Road, known for its wide range of educational books at affordable prices.
Begin your day by visiting the Indian Institute of Management Bangalore (IIMB) for a guided tour of the campus and to learn about management education in India. Afterward, head to the HAL Aerospace Museum to explore the rich aviation history of India. Get up close to various aircraft, flight simulators, and aerospace exhibits. In the afternoon, visit the Karnataka Chitrakala Parishath, an art complex showcasing a range of artistic expressions through paintings, sculptures, and handicrafts. End your day with a visit to Cubbon Park, a lush green space ideal for relaxing and enjoying nature.
On your last day, explore the heritage site of Bengaluru Palace. Admire the stunning architecture and learn about the royal history of Bangalore. From there, visit the Bull Temple, dedicated to the sacred bull Nandi, a prominent Hindu deity. Experience the religious and cultural significance of this historical temple. In the afternoon, head to the Karnataka State Science and Technology Centre for engaging exhibits and demonstrations on various scientific principles. Wrap up your tour by visiting the National Aerospace Laboratories to gain insights into the research and development of aviation and aerospace technologies in India.
For off the beaten path attractions and places loved by locals, consider visiting the Indian Music Experience. It houses an extensive collection of musical instruments, offering visitors an immersive experience into the rich musical heritage of India. Another hidden gem is the National Gallery of Ancient Art, situated inside the Bengaluru Palace, showcasing exquisite ancient paintings and artifacts. Don't miss the chance to try the local street food delicacies at food stalls near VV Puram Food Street, known for its delicious and affordable culinary delights. It's a great way to experience the local flavors of Bangalore.
